Historic Markers Near Old Tappan, NJ
5 historical markers from the Historical Marker Database (HMdb) found near Old Tappan, NJ.
| Name | Description |
|---|---|
| John Haring, Jr. House | Marker is at the intersection of Old Tappan Road and Leoson Pkwy, on the right when traveling west on Old Tappan Road. |
| Blauvelt-Seaman House | Marker is at the intersection of Rivervale Road and James Lane, on the left when traveling north on Rivervale Road. |
| Baylor Massacre Park | Marker is at the intersection of Red Oak Drive and Rivervale Road, on the right when traveling east on Red Oak Drive. |
| Haring - DeWolf House | Marker is on DeWolf Road, on the left when traveling north. |
| Teunis Haring House | Marker is at the intersection of Old Tappan Road and Orangeburgh Road, on the right when traveling west on Old Tappan Road. |
